Senior Pricing & Commercial Specialist
The Senior Pricing & Commercial Specialist is a key member of the Finance organization and is responsible for managing Third party pricing execution, commercial analysis, and pricing support across all sales channels. This role leads the administration and management of all price lists, customer-specific pricing structures, margin analysis, and commercial program support.
The position works closely with Finance and Sales leadership (all segments PNA, SCT) to support product pricing strategy through data analysis, pricing execution, margin visibility, and commercial insights. This individual will operate within existing systems and data structures while coordinating cross-functionally with Sales, Accounting, Sourcing, Operations, Product Management, Market Development, OEM and global manufacturing teams to support accurate pricing and profitability analysis.
This role is not responsible for cost accounting ownership or establishing product costs but is responsible for utilizing cost inputs from cost accounting to support pricing analysis, margin tracking, and commercial decision-making.
This role operates within the PNA finance organization, maintaining a dotted-line reporting relationship to PNA/SCT sales across all segments. This financial alignment ensures robust internal control mechanisms, such as the four-eye principle, while improving cross-departmental collaboration. Additionally, it streamlines gross profit analysis, budget creation, and forecasting by minimizing friction between teams.
